一、技术定位与核心价值
RemoteApp是面向企业级用户的远程应用交付解决方案,通过将应用程序运行在云端或数据中心服务器,以流式传输方式将用户界面投射至终端设备。这种架构实现了三个核心价值:
- 资源集中化:所有应用数据与计算资源存储在数据中心,终端设备仅作为显示与输入终端,有效降低数据泄露风险
- 体验本地化:用户通过独立窗口操作远程应用,支持剪贴板共享、本地打印机映射等交互功能
- 运维高效化:IT部门可统一管理应用版本与安全补丁,避免终端设备兼容性问题
典型应用场景包括:分支机构访问总部核心系统、外包团队使用内部业务软件、移动办公场景下的安全访问等。某金融企业部署后,终端设备管理成本降低65%,应用部署周期从3天缩短至2小时。
二、技术架构深度解析
1. 协议栈设计
采用分层协议架构实现高效数据传输:
- 表示层:基于RDP 10协议实现像素级画面压缩与传输,支持32位色彩深度与H.264/AVC硬件编码
- 传输层:通过TS Gateway技术封装RDP流量至HTTPS(443端口),规避传统VPN的端口限制与性能瓶颈
- 会话层:支持多用户并发会话管理,每个会话独立分配计算资源与存储空间
# 示例:通过PowerShell配置TS Gateway连接$gatewayCredential = Get-CredentialNew-RDCertificate -Role TSGateway -Path "C:\certs\gateway.pfx"Set-Item WSMan:\localhost\Service\AllowUnencrypted -Value $false
2. 资源调度机制
采用动态资源分配算法优化服务器利用率:
- CPU调度:基于Docker容器实现应用进程隔离,每个容器分配2-4个vCPU核心
- 内存管理:采用内存气球驱动技术,动态回收空闲内存资源
- 存储优化:通过FSLogix技术实现用户配置文件虚拟化,减少I/O延迟
三、关键技术优势
1. 安全防护体系
构建三重防护机制:
- 传输加密:采用TLS 1.3协议加密数据流,支持AES-256加密算法
- 访问控制:集成AD域认证与多因素认证(MFA),支持条件访问策略
- 数据隔离:每个用户会话运行在独立命名空间,防止进程间数据泄露
2. 性能优化策略
通过三项技术实现低延迟体验:
- 智能压缩:根据画面内容动态选择JPEG/PNG压缩算法,带宽占用降低40%
- 边缘计算:在CDN节点部署应用代理,使平均延迟控制在80ms以内
- 预加载技术:基于用户行为分析预加载常用应用模块,缩短启动时间
3. 跨平台支持
实现全终端覆盖:
- Windows客户端:原生支持RDP协议,提供最佳兼容性
- macOS/Linux:通过FreeRDP开源库实现跨平台访问
- 移动端:开发轻量化SDK,支持iOS/Android设备触控优化
四、实施部署指南
1. 环境准备要求
- 服务器配置:建议使用双路Xeon Platinum处理器,配备256GB内存与NVMe SSD
- 网络要求:核心交换机需支持DSCP优先级标记,QoS策略保障RDP流量带宽
- 软件依赖:Windows Server 2019以上版本,安装Remote Desktop Services角色
2. 典型部署架构
采用三层架构设计:
- 接入层:部署TS Gateway集群,实现SSL卸载与负载均衡
- 计算层:构建应用虚拟化主机池,每台主机运行8-12个应用实例
- 存储层:使用分布式文件系统存储用户数据,配置RAID 6保护机制
3. 性能调优参数
关键配置项建议值:
| 参数项 | 推荐值 | 说明 |
|———————————|————————|—————————————|
| 最大会话数 | 200/服务器 | 根据CPU核心数动态调整 |
| 音频重定向质量 | 中等质量 | 平衡带宽与音质 |
| 图形模式 | 硬件加速 | 需GPU虚拟化支持 |
| 压缩算法 | 自动选择 | 根据网络状况动态调整 |
五、运维管理最佳实践
1. 监控体系构建
部署三维度监控方案:
- 基础设施监控:通过Prometheus采集服务器CPU/内存/磁盘指标
- 应用性能监控:使用APM工具跟踪应用响应时间与错误率
- 用户体验监控:通过合成监控模拟真实用户操作路径
2. 故障排查流程
建立标准化处理流程:
- 连接失败:检查443端口连通性,验证证书有效性
- 画面卡顿:分析网络延迟与丢包率,调整压缩参数
- 功能异常:检查组策略配置,验证用户权限设置
3. 容量规划方法
采用动态扩展策略:
- 基于历史数据:分析过去30天的并发连接数峰值
- 预留缓冲空间:按峰值负载的120%配置资源
- 自动伸缩机制:设置CPU利用率阈值触发扩容脚本
六、技术演进趋势
随着零信任架构的普及,RemoteApp技术正朝着三个方向发展:
- AI驱动运维:通过机器学习预测资源需求,实现自动扩缩容
- 增强现实集成:探索AR终端访问企业应用的可行性
- 区块链认证:研究去中心化身份验证机制提升安全性
某行业研究报告显示,采用新一代RemoteApp方案的企业,其远程办公效率提升38%,安全事件发生率下降72%。这充分证明该技术已成为企业数字化转型的关键基础设施组件。
通过系统化的技术架构设计与精细化运维管理,RemoteApp能够有效解决传统远程办公方案中的性能瓶颈与安全隐患。建议企业在实施时重点关注网络质量优化与安全策略配置,定期进行压力测试与容量评估,确保系统稳定运行。